Summary
Student will be introduced into the structure of telecommunication networks which part are the access network. The access network can be divided into metallic, optic and wireless. There will be given the information about basic characteristic, principles and interfaces of each area. Student will be able to characterize now-a-day technologies and development trends as well.

Course Contents
Lectures:

Structure of telecommunication networks, access networks, metodology of access to common tranfer medium
Access metodology used in acess networks - TDMA, FDMA, WDMA, SCMA, CDMA.
Interface between access network and local node, groupe of protocols of Interface V5.
Metalic access network, features of metalic line, link code, modulation
Access technology xDSL, digital loops IDSL, ADSL, VDSL, BDSL.
Optical access networks, features of OLT and ONU, optical distribution network, PON and AON.
Narrowband optical networks, features and control.
Distribution, optical and hybrid access networks.
Multifunction broadband access networks.
Radio access networks.
DECT.
Bluetooth.
Systems of 802.11 standard.
Access networks in Europe, development and trends.
